AngularJS Web Development: Hands-On Projects

Learn to build and maintain dynamic web applications using AngularJS through structured, practical projects and modern JavaScript practices.

4.3 (852) ⏱ 1 ساعة 35 دقيقة 📚 5 درس 🎧 النسخة الصوتية

حول هذه الدورة

AngularJS remains a critical framework powering thousands of enterprise web applications worldwide. Whether you need to maintain legacy systems or understand the architectural foundations of modern front-end frameworks, mastering AngularJS is a highly valuable skill. This text-based course guides you from foundational concepts to building functional web applications. You will learn how to structure applications, manage data-binding, and implement component-based architectures to write clean, maintainable code. What you'll learn: - Understand core AngularJS concepts including modules, controllers, and scope - Implement two-way data binding to synchronize data between models and views automatically - Create custom directives and components to extend HTML and build reusable UI elements - Manage application state and services using dependency injection - Apply modern ES6+ JavaScript syntax to improve legacy AngularJS codebases - Build and structure multiple practical web applications from scratch The course begins with essential terminology and structural concepts before guiding you through step-by-step written projects. You will explore how to decouple client-side logic from the server, organize code into modules, and apply best practices for maintaining older codebases. This course is designed for beginners to AngularJS and developers tasked with maintaining legacy web applications. A basic understanding of HTML, CSS, and JavaScript is recommended. Start reading today to master AngularJS and confidently manage dynamic web applications.

ما الذي ستحصل عليه

  • 📜 شهادة إتمام
    أضفها إلى ملفك على LinkedIn
  • 💬 Personal AI tutor
    Stuck on a lesson? Ask your built-in tutor anything, any time.
  • 🎧 النسخة الصوتية مضمَّنة
    تعلَّم أثناء تنقُّلك — دون شاشة
  • ♾️ وصول مدى الحياة
    عُد متى شئت، بلا انتهاء
  • 📱 الهاتف أو الكمبيوتر
    يعمل في أي مكان وعلى أي جهاز
  • 💸 استرداد خلال 30 يومًا
    دون أسئلة
  • قصير ومركَّز
    1 ساعة 35 دقيقة من المحتوى التطبيقي

المراجعات (6)

André Neves PT متعلِّم موثَّق
★ 5 · 2026-04-09T03:44:54+00:00

This is exactly what I was looking for. Loved the practical examples, they really helped solidify the concepts.

Lenka Kučerová CZ
★ 4 · 2026-03-02T16:03:54+00:00

Learned a ton and the structure made it easy to follow along. Loved the practical application examples they provided.

มนตรี สุขเสมอ TH متعلِّم موثَّق
★ 3 · 2026-02-04T05:00:54+00:00

لقد كانت تجربة تعلم رائعة، كانت السرعة مثالية، والأمثلة عززت المفاهيم حقا، إبهام كبير إلى الأعلى!

สมศักดิ์ คงมั่น TH متعلِّم موثَّق
★ 5 · 2025-12-19T01:23:54+00:00

لقد تجاوزت هذه الدورة توقعاتي. والتطبيقات في العالم الحقيقي التي نوقشت مفيدة بشكل لا يصدق. عمل رائع!

Jaanus Mägi EE متعلِّم موثَّق
★ 4 · 2025-03-29T22:41:54+00:00

Overall a positive experience. I appreciated the clear objectives for each module. Could have benefited from more interactive elements.

Ava White AU متعلِّم موثَّق
★ 5 · 2025-02-24T17:49:54+00:00

Loved the practical application examples. Exactly the kind of hands-on learning I was looking for.

اكتب مراجعة

سنطلب منك تسجيل الدخول بعد الإرسال — تُحفظ مسودتك.

المتعلمون أخذوا أيضًا

الأسئلة الشائعة

ما الذي أحتاجه لأخذ هذه الدورة؟ +

يكفي هاتف أو كمبيوتر متصل بالإنترنت. بدون تثبيتات أو أجهزة خاصة.

كيف يمكنني الدفع؟ +

بالبطاقة عبر Stripe أو بالعملات الرقمية. لا نخزن بيانات البطاقة — يتولى Stripe ذلك بأمان.

هل يمكنني استرداد المال؟ +

نعم — استرداد كامل خلال 30 يومًا، دون أسئلة.

إلى متى يستمر وصولي؟ +

إلى الأبد. بمجرد الشراء، الدورة لك تعود إليها متى شئت.

هل سأحصل على شهادة؟ +

نعم. عند الإتمام ستحصل على شهادة يمكنك إضافتها إلى ملفك في LinkedIn.

مصمَّم للعاملين في
التقنية التصميم المالية التسويق الرعاية الصحية التعليم الضيافة التصنيع